0
Skip to Content
Home
About
Contact
Blog
FAQs
Quote
Request Service
Open Menu
Close Menu
Home
About
Contact
Blog
FAQs
Quote
Request Service
Open Menu
Close Menu
Home
About
Contact
Blog
FAQs
Quote
Request Service
Let’s work together
Request your free estimate: